[kforge-user] provide-kforge-0.13b1 released
John Bywater
john.bywater at appropriatesoftware.net
Thu Aug 9 11:34:07 UTC 2007
Hi Matthew,
Thanks a lot. I've fixed KForge now so that test uses a mock email
dispatcher, rather than the real thing.
Please download this new Provide script to your Provide's 'bin' folder:
http://project.kforge.appropriatesoftware.net/provide/svn/trunk/bin/provide-kforge-0.13b1
Make it executable and run it (as the provide user).
This time, it should all run through OK, without any test failures, and
result in a functional KForge installation. The problem with styles and
the uri_prefix is now also fixed (I'm told).
(However, as Provide doesn't quite calculate and substitute uri_prefixes
into provided services, you'll need to edit your new kforge.conf file to
set the uri_prefix (run: provide serviceconfig kforge 0.13b1
production), and then rebuild the KForge service Apache config (run: cd
$your-new-kforge-service-folder; ./scriptrunner "./bin/kforge-admin www
build" ). This step will be unnecessary after the end of this week.)
But please report on what happens!
Best wishes,
John.
Matthew Brett wrote:
> Hi John,
>
>
>> Please download this new Provide script to your Provide's 'bin' folder:
>>
>> http://project.kforge.appropriatesoftware.net/provide/svn/trunk/bin/provide-kforge-0.13a5
>>
>> Make it executable and run it (as the provide user). I expect it to
>> terminate on 1 failing test.
>>
>
> Your expectations were confirmed, error appended...
>
> Matthew
>
> ======================================================================
> ERROR: test_1 (kforge.command.misctest.TestEmailNewPassword)
> ----------------------------------------------------------------------
> Traceback (most recent call last):
> File "/home/provide/provided/0.2/var/provisions/kforge/applications/0.13a5/services/testing/live/lib/python/kforge-0.13a5-py2.4.egg/kforge/command/misctest.py",
> line 25, in test_1
> File "/home/provide/provided/0.2/var/provisions/kforge/applications/0.13a5/services/testing/live/lib/python/kforge-0.13a5-py2.4.egg/kforge/command/misc.py",
> line 27, in execute
> File "/home/provide/provided/0.2/var/provisions/kforge/applications/0.13a5/services/testing/live/lib/python/kforge-0.13a5-py2.4.egg/kforge/command/misc.py",
> line 47, in _sendEmail
> File "/home/provide/provided/0.2/var/provisions/kforge/applications/0.13a5/services/testing/live/lib/python/kforge-0.13a5-py2.4.egg/kforge/utils/mailer.py",
> line 16, in send
> File "/usr/local/lib/python2.4/smtplib.py", line 688, in sendmail
> raise SMTPRecipientsRefused(senderrs)
> SMTPRecipientsRefused: {'levin at imaging.mrc-cbu.cam.ac.uk': (450,
> '<levin at imaging.mrc-cbu.cam.ac.uk>: User unknown in local recipient
> table')}
>
>
>
>
--
Appropriate Software Foundation
Registered in England and Wales
17 Chapel Street, Hyde Cheshire
Company number: 04977110
W: appropriatesoftware.net
T: 0870 720 2944
M: 0781 139 2292
More information about the kforge-user
mailing list